Pacers vs Jazz: Indiana Favored in Monday Night Matchup at Delta Center
The Indiana Pacers will face off against the Utah Jazz on Monday, February 3, during the 2024-25 NBA season at the Delta Center in Salt Lake City, UT. This will be the first meeting between the two teams this season, as they split a two-game set in the previous season. Indiana is the betting favorite with an opening line of -7, which has not moved. Betting Odds
- Moneyline: Pacers -290 | Jazz +230
- Spread: Pacers -7 (-110) | Jazz +7 (-110)
- Total: Over/Under 236 (-110)
- Based on the moneyline, the implied probability that Indiana will win straight-up is 74%.
Indiana vs Utah Stats
Indiana Pacers
The Indiana Pacers have shown significant improvement in recent games, winning 11 out of their last 13 matches. They are currently on a three-game winning streak, defeating the San Antonio Spurs, Detroit Pistons, and Atlanta Hawks. Although they failed to cover a 9.5-point spread in their last game against the Hawks, Pascal Siakam's performance stood out with 20 points, nine rebounds, and five assists. The Pacers have a balanced offensive attack with seven players averaging double figures in points per game, including Siakam and Tyrese Haliburton. They have a strong offensive rating of 116.1 points per 100 possessions, ranking 8th in the NBA, while their defensive rating is at 114.9 points allowed per possession, placing them 20th. Overall, the Pacers have a record of 27-20 this season, ranking 8th in offense and 22nd in defense. Their shooting percentages and assist-to-turnover ratios position them favorably in the league rankings.
Utah Jazz Analysis
The Utah Jazz recently won against the Orlando Magic, breaking an eight-game losing streak. The team's top scorers include Collin Sexton, John Collins, and Lauri Markkanen. However, despite their offensive prowess, the Jazz rank low in defensive efficiency. They have a power ranking of 21 and are ranked #20 for offense and #28 for defense, with an overall record of 11-36. The team averages 45.67% field goal shooting, 78.71% free throw shooting, and 35.49% three-point shooting. On defense, they allow 47.96% field goals, 76.08% free throws, and 36.02% three-pointers. The Jazz also average 44.85 rebounds, 25.13 offensive assists, and 16.78 turnovers per game. Overall, the team has room for improvement on defense to complement their strong offensive performance.
Utah Jazz Face Tough Challenge Against High-Scoring Indiana Pacers
The Utah Jazz recently limited the Orlando Magic to 99 points, demonstrating their defensive prowess. However, it is important to note that the Magic have struggled offensively as of late. The Jazz will face a tough challenge when they play the Indiana Pacers, who have consistently scored over 130 points in their last three games. The Pacers have been performing exceptionally well, averaging 118.6 points per 100 possessions while also maintaining a strong defensive record, only allowing 110.4 points in return. Given their recent form, it is likely that the Pacers will emerge victorious against the Jazz and cover the spread. The Pacers prioritize ball security and attacking the paint, which could pose problems for the Jazz, who have struggled with defending inside shots and turnovers. In terms of betting trends, the Jazz have not performed well ATS in recent games, while the Pacers have been more successful in covering the spread both overall and on the road.
